Impact In This Role

When a sales organization begins to scale to support a growing company, sales operations and strategy become vital functions. With more channels, customers, and revenue comes the need for meaningful KPIs to track and measure sales effectiveness and productivity in order to scale the organization with the right people at the right time for the right roles.

With double-digit growth quarter over quarter and year over year, the Director, Sales Strategy Operations will work alongside the CRO and the sales leadership team to make the right investment decisions at the right time. They will be responsible for driving operational excellence and strategic initiatives within the sales organization. This role involves analyzing sales data, developing sales growth strategies, and implementing processes to increase efficiency and effectiveness.

The Director, Sales Strategy Operations collaborates closely with the sales team, finance, and other cross-functional departments to align sales operations with business objectives and support revenue growth.

You will report to the Chief Revenue Officer.

What You’ll Be Doing

Deep Sales Analysis and Proactive Reporting:

  • Analyze sales data and performance metrics to identify trends, opportunities, and areas for sales productivity improvements.
  • Generate regular sales reports and dashboards for management, providing insights and recommendations based on data analysis.
  • Build QBR Quantitative data for each Business Unit Leader and review with the business leaders to help find and tell the story of opportunities and gaps.
  • Monitor key performance indicators (KPIs) to track sales team performance and provide actionable insights for continuous improvement.

Sales Strategy Development:

  • Collaborate with Fictiv leadership to develop and refine sales strategies and objectives.
  • Conduct market research and competitive analysis to identify market trends, customer needs, and potential growth opportunities or new sales channels/models we should explore, new business units we should add, or new roles we should do.
  • Identify areas for sales process improvement and propose strategic initiatives to drive revenue growth.
  • Work with the CRO and her leadership team to develop the next fiscal year's compensation plans to optimize results.

Sales Process Optimization:

  • Streamline sales processes and workflows to improve efficiency and effectiveness.
  • Support the development of sales tools, sales enablement methodologies, and best practices to enhance sales team productivity.
  • Identify and implement sales enablement initiatives to improve sales effectiveness and support the achievement of sales targets.

Sales Forecasting and Planning:

  • Collaborate with finance and sales leadership to develop accurate sales forecasts and revenue projections.
  • Monitor sales pipeline and provide insights to support accurate forecasting and resource allocation.
  • Assist in developing sales quotas and territory assignments based on market potential and sales objectives and provide continual feedback on territory adjustments to ensure we maximize opportunities.

Cross-Functional Collaboration:

  • Work closely with finance, marketing, operations, and other departments to ensure alignment and collaboration in sales-related initiatives and to build out commensurate capacity as required in marketing programs, people, etc.
  • Collaborate with IT to ensure effective utilization and integration of sales tools and systems.
  • Act as a liaison between sales and other departments to address operational issues and foster effective communication and collaboration.
  • Work closely with the People Ops team to support performance tracking and measurement.

Our story

Fictiv was founded in 2013 to eliminate a major bottleneck in new product development: custom mechanical part sourcing.

The traditional process of finding, vetting, and managing suppliers, getting quotes, and tracking orders across many vendors is incredibly resource-intensive and fraught with miscommunication, delays, and mistakes. These barriers make hardware development a slow, painful, high-risk endeavor.

Fictiv has engineered a new approach — one that streamlines workflows to eliminate the barriers to innovation and unleashes the creativity of engineers.

How? We’ve built an intelligent custom manufacturing operating system, to deliver speed, connect you to a group of globally-networked and highly-specialized manufacturing partners, and ensure success by applying a team of dedicated and caring quality engineers, logistics specialists, supply chain managers, and customer success representatives.
